William was born on March 10, 1944 and passed away on Friday, July 5, 2019. William was a resident of Quincy, Massachusetts at the time of passing. Remembering William Carl (Billy) Lucci Current and Recent Services ? William Carl (Billy) Lucci March 10, 1944 - July 5, 2019 Burial Date July 11, 2019 Pine Hill Cemetery Church St. John the Baptist Parish Guestbook (2) Church William "Billy" Carl Lucci of Quincy, MA passed away unexpectedly at his home on July 5, 2019. On Thursday there will be a gathering at the funeral home at 10:30AM followed by a Funeral Mass at 11:30AM at St. John the Baptist Church 44 School St. Quincy. Burial will follow at Pine Hill Cemetery 815 Willard St. West Quincy.
